Niklas Merz [Wed, 10 Feb 2021 16:56:58 +0000 (17:56 +0100)]
Updated version and RELEASENOTES.md for release 5.0.0 (cordova-plugin-inappbrowser-5.0.0)
Niklas Merz [Tue, 9 Feb 2021 07:24:56 +0000 (08:24 +0100)]
feat(ios): add InAppBrowserStatusBarStyle 'darkcontent' configuration option (#828)
Co-authored-by: Tim Brust <github@timbrust.de>
jcesarmobile [Tue, 9 Feb 2021 07:24:17 +0000 (08:24 +0100)]
chore: bump engines requirements (#823)
* chore: bump engines requirements
* bump cordova-ios to >=6.0.0
jcesarmobile [Wed, 20 Jan 2021 16:43:28 +0000 (17:43 +0100)]
breaking: cleanup code for old android versions (#824)
jcesarmobile [Wed, 20 Jan 2021 16:30:10 +0000 (17:30 +0100)]
chore: bump version to 5.0.0-dev (#822)
Niklas Merz [Thu, 7 Jan 2021 18:21:57 +0000 (19:21 +0100)]
(ios): rename CDVWKProcessPoolFactory (#825)
* (ios): rename CDVWKProcessPoolFactory
CDVWKProcessPoolFactory was integrated from the WKWebView plugin with
the new name: CDVWebViewProcessPoolFactory
* (ios): Allow both processpool imports
エリス [Sat, 28 Nov 2020 10:50:04 +0000 (19:50 +0900)]
ci: add node-14.x to workflow (#826)
jcesarmobile [Tue, 24 Nov 2020 14:49:09 +0000 (15:49 +0100)]
breaking(android): replace magic numbers with android.os.Build constants (#821)
Niklas Merz [Mon, 23 Nov 2020 09:21:18 +0000 (10:21 +0100)]
ci(ios): remove wkwebview plugin (#717)
cordova-ios@6.x makes the WKWebView plugin obsolete.
Co-authored-by: Erisu <ellis.bryan@gmail.com>
Niklas Merz [Tue, 17 Nov 2020 18:22:20 +0000 (19:22 +0100)]
Incremented plugin version. (cordova-plugin-inappbrowser-4.1.0)
Niklas Merz [Tue, 17 Nov 2020 18:08:59 +0000 (19:08 +0100)]
Updated version and RELEASENOTES.md for release 4.1.0
Niklas Merz [Tue, 17 Nov 2020 17:57:37 +0000 (18:57 +0100)]
chore(npm): fix npm audit issues automatically (#819)
Carl Poole [Tue, 17 Nov 2020 16:32:05 +0000 (10:32 -0600)]
fix(android): Add mitigation strategy for CVE-2020-6506 (#792)
wrightsonm [Tue, 17 Nov 2020 14:37:32 +0000 (14:37 +0000)]
Updated typings (#817)
Co-authored-by: Tim Brust <github@timbrust.de>
Co-authored-by: Mark <mark.wrightson@spreadex.com>
jcesarmobile [Wed, 21 Oct 2020 14:17:14 +0000 (16:17 +0200)]
fix(android): allow compilation in old cordova-android versions (#803)
Niklas Merz [Sat, 19 Sep 2020 23:48:32 +0000 (01:48 +0200)]
(ios): allow to set "preferredContentMode" (#688)
PreferredContentMode can now be set with preference config. Since iPadOS came out iPads get a desktop Safari useragent by default.
see #687
Co-authored-by: Tim Brust <github@timbrust.de>
エリス [Thu, 3 Sep 2020 10:34:47 +0000 (19:34 +0900)]
ci(travis): update osx xcode image (#768)
* ci(travis): update osx xcode image
* ci: use travis's latest supported osx_image xcode11.6
Dave Alden [Tue, 1 Sep 2020 15:41:53 +0000 (16:41 +0100)]
Merge pull request #765 from mrbberra/master
(ios) Add InAppBrowserStatusBarStyle preference. Resolves #728
Tim Brust [Sat, 22 Aug 2020 12:33:50 +0000 (12:33 +0000)]
ci(travis): updates Android API level (#767)
Moses Berra [Tue, 18 Aug 2020 18:22:48 +0000 (13:22 -0500)]
add documentation for InAppBrowserStatusBarStyle preference
Moses Berra [Tue, 18 Aug 2020 17:45:52 +0000 (12:45 -0500)]
undo whitespace changes due to editor preferrences
Moses Berra [Tue, 18 Aug 2020 17:40:13 +0000 (12:40 -0500)]
ios: added InAppBrowserStatusBarStyle preference (#728)
Dave Alden [Thu, 23 Jul 2020 11:50:21 +0000 (12:50 +0100)]
Merge pull request #738 from lazydan/master
(ios): Fix incorrect view height from the second open time
Tim Brust [Fri, 3 Jul 2020 18:50:02 +0000 (18:50 +0000)]
chore: adds package-lock file (#748)
Tim Brust [Fri, 3 Jul 2020 13:31:23 +0000 (13:31 +0000)]
chore(npm): use short notation in package.json (#746)
Tim Brust [Thu, 2 Jul 2020 15:41:21 +0000 (15:41 +0000)]
refactor(eslint): use cordova-eslint /w fix (#747)
jcesarmobile [Mon, 22 Jun 2020 09:44:39 +0000 (11:44 +0200)]
fix(ios): exit event not fired on swipe down (#737)
lazydan [Fri, 19 Jun 2020 16:56:52 +0000 (00:56 +0800)]
(ios): Fix incorrect view height from the second open time
Niklas Merz [Tue, 9 Jun 2020 16:57:10 +0000 (18:57 +0200)]
Incremented plugin version. (cordova-plugin-inappbrowser-4.0.0)
Niklas Merz [Tue, 9 Jun 2020 16:54:58 +0000 (18:54 +0200)]
Updated version and RELEASENOTES.md for release 4.0.0 (cordova-plugin-inappbrowser-4.0.0)
Niklas Merz [Fri, 5 Jun 2020 13:23:10 +0000 (15:23 +0200)]
(ios): fix regression in
2706f34 (#715)
Fix merging issue from #656
Closes #714
jcesarmobile [Thu, 4 Jun 2020 14:48:03 +0000 (16:48 +0200)]
chore: update install engines (#685)
PDLMobileApps [Thu, 4 Jun 2020 14:32:07 +0000 (10:32 -0400)]
(ios) Remove fake status bar with hardcoded height to fix issues in iOS devices with a notch (#656)
* (ios) Removed fake statusbar with hardcoded height to fix issues in iOS devices with a notch
* (ios) Removed no longer needed bgToolbar
* (ios) Fixed issue with rotation in landscape mode and refactored/simplified the code
Co-authored-by: Alessandro Basso <Alessandro.Basso@PeapodDigitalLabs.com>
Dani Palou [Sat, 16 May 2020 22:24:36 +0000 (00:24 +0200)]
fix(ios): Allow loading local html files (#693)
Nicolas HENRY [Fri, 8 May 2020 12:02:39 +0000 (14:02 +0200)]
GH-292 android: SSL errors handling in Android (#293)
jcesarmobile [Mon, 27 Apr 2020 15:54:02 +0000 (17:54 +0200)]
fix(ios): prevent statusbar rotation after closing InAppBrowser (#672)
Erisu [Wed, 22 Apr 2020 04:41:11 +0000 (13:41 +0900)]
chore(asf): update git notification settings
csware [Tue, 14 Apr 2020 17:22:08 +0000 (19:22 +0200)]
Allow App using inappbrowser to be hosted in a cross-origin ifra… (#669)
Signed-off-by: Sven Strickroth <email@cs-ware.de>
Niklas Merz [Tue, 14 Apr 2020 13:25:54 +0000 (15:25 +0200)]
(all platforms): remove "window.open" overwrite (#600)
Closes #599
Tim Brust [Tue, 14 Apr 2020 12:56:53 +0000 (12:56 +0000)]
chore: bump version to 4.0.0-dev (#670)
Niklas Merz [Mon, 13 Apr 2020 12:29:50 +0000 (14:29 +0200)]
Update CONTRIBUTING.md
Tim Brust [Tue, 7 Apr 2020 13:20:36 +0000 (13:20 +0000)]
docs: replaces outdated transition and presentation style links (#662)
jcesarmobile [Mon, 6 Apr 2020 13:21:22 +0000 (15:21 +0200)]
chore: remove deprecated orientation methods (#666)
Kamil Burek [Fri, 3 Apr 2020 12:08:32 +0000 (13:08 +0100)]
Fix incorrect TypeScript typings (#515)
* fix #514
* Update based on conversation in #514
* Fixed whitespace
Jim Wright [Mon, 30 Mar 2020 10:47:30 +0000 (11:47 +0100)]
[GH-652] add check for openInSystem postNotification (#654)
Co-authored-by: Jim Wright <jim.wright@masabi.com>
Tim Brust [Fri, 27 Mar 2020 18:24:32 +0000 (18:24 +0000)]
ci: updates Node.js versions (#659)
Tim Brust [Fri, 27 Mar 2020 18:24:22 +0000 (18:24 +0000)]
chore(npm): improve ignore list (#658)
Jesse MacFadyen [Wed, 25 Mar 2020 18:08:04 +0000 (11:08 -0700)]
fix(android): Reset lefttoright if not set (#442)
This fixes #441
Mosab A [Wed, 25 Mar 2020 17:18:41 +0000 (19:18 +0200)]
[android] Correcting the documentation regarding lefttoright opt… (#648)
PDLMobileApps [Tue, 24 Mar 2020 13:24:14 +0000 (09:24 -0400)]
(android) Added option to turn on/off fullscreen mode in Android (#634)
* (android) Added option to turn on/off fullscreen mode in Android
* (android) Reverted version changes as requested
* (android) Changing default option value to enabled as per request
Co-authored-by: Alessandro Basso <Alessandro.Basso@PeapodDigitalLabs.com>
Slayterik [Fri, 20 Mar 2020 14:07:48 +0000 (17:07 +0300)]
Android GH-470 InAppBrowser: java.lang.IllegalArgumentException (#616)
Fix interacting with views when Activity destroyed
Bug description https://stackoverflow.com/questions/
22924825/view-not-attached-to-window-manager-crash
Co-authored-by: Sarafanov Valeriy <sarafanov_v@firma-gamma.ru>
jcesarmobile [Thu, 5 Mar 2020 14:51:31 +0000 (15:51 +0100)]
breaking(ios): remove UIWebView (#635)
Niklas Merz [Mon, 6 Jan 2020 06:23:15 +0000 (07:23 +0100)]
chore(release): 3.2.1-dev
Niklas Merz [Mon, 6 Jan 2020 06:20:07 +0000 (07:20 +0100)]
(ios) fix regression in injectScriptFile
Fixes issue introduced in #584
Niklas Merz [Sat, 4 Jan 2020 08:43:11 +0000 (09:43 +0100)]
chore(release): release notes for 3.2.0
Niklas Merz [Sat, 4 Jan 2020 08:24:36 +0000 (09:24 +0100)]
chore(release): 3.2.0 (version string)
Niklas Merz [Sat, 4 Jan 2020 07:57:52 +0000 (08:57 +0100)]
Merge pull request #503 from alexyazvinsky/def-fix
(android) Defensive code to prevent NULL reference exceptions for async
Maik Hummel [Wed, 27 Nov 2019 16:25:59 +0000 (17:25 +0100)]
(ios) add compile-time decision for disabling UIWebView (#584)
Niklas Merz [Thu, 2 Jan 2020 20:27:59 +0000 (21:27 +0100)]
chore(release): 3.2.0-dev
Niklas Merz [Thu, 2 Jan 2020 18:53:36 +0000 (19:53 +0100)]
(android) improve defensive code for NULL check
Alex Yaz [Tue, 26 Mar 2019 14:46:49 +0000 (10:46 -0400)]
(android) defensive code to prevent NULL reference exceptions for async
Signed-off-by: Niklas Merz <niklasmerz@apache.org>
Lorenzo B [Mon, 30 Dec 2019 09:47:37 +0000 (10:47 +0100)]
Replace "beforeload" with BEFORELOAD (#524)
Improve code formatting
mosababubakr [Mon, 4 Nov 2019 15:23:44 +0000 (17:23 +0200)]
Update missing closed brace to the insert.CSS (#568)
Norman Breau [Sun, 3 Nov 2019 15:09:54 +0000 (11:09 -0400)]
Merge pull request #567 from mosababubakr/patch-1
Update missing closed brace to the insert.CSS
mosababubakr [Sun, 3 Nov 2019 14:56:59 +0000 (16:56 +0200)]
Update missing closed brace to the insert.CSS
Dave Alden [Tue, 24 Sep 2019 15:21:19 +0000 (16:21 +0100)]
Merge pull request #401 from GEDYSIntraWare/bridge
Move bridge creation to injectDeferredObject
Dave Alden [Tue, 24 Sep 2019 14:43:48 +0000 (15:43 +0100)]
Merge pull request #534 from GEDYSIntraWare/fix-show-ios13
Fix inappbrowser not opening on iOS 13 by using reusable window. Resolves #492
Niklas Merz [Tue, 24 Sep 2019 14:28:07 +0000 (16:28 +0200)]
Fix unresponsive main window after hide
Niklas Merz [Mon, 23 Sep 2019 08:29:31 +0000 (10:29 +0200)]
Move window hiding to 'browserExit'
Fixes close, hide and toolbar 'done' and makes cordova window responsive
Niklas Merz [Fri, 20 Sep 2019 13:48:27 +0000 (15:48 +0200)]
New fix attempt
Niklas Merz [Fri, 20 Sep 2019 11:43:57 +0000 (13:43 +0200)]
Use tmpWindow and hide on close
Niklas Merz [Fri, 6 Sep 2019 12:14:51 +0000 (14:14 +0200)]
(ios) Fix iOS 13 show not working
Removed tmpWindow and controller.
This was introduced to fix IAB with WKWebView before WKIAB existed.
Niklas Merz [Fri, 6 Sep 2019 11:53:36 +0000 (13:53 +0200)]
Finish revert and correct Xcode warnings
Niklas Merz [Fri, 6 Sep 2019 06:29:55 +0000 (08:29 +0200)]
(ios) Fix inappbrowser not opening on iOS 13 by using reusable window
Closes #492
Jan Piotrowski [Mon, 1 Jul 2019 18:26:57 +0000 (20:26 +0200)]
ci(travis): upgrade to node8
Jan Piotrowski [Thu, 27 Jun 2019 21:31:13 +0000 (23:31 +0200)]
chore(release): 3.1.1-dev
Jan Piotrowski [Thu, 27 Jun 2019 21:20:54 +0000 (23:20 +0200)]
chore(release): 3.1.0 (version string)
Jan Piotrowski [Thu, 27 Jun 2019 21:20:54 +0000 (23:20 +0200)]
chore(release): release notes for 3.1.0
Jan Piotrowski [Thu, 27 Jun 2019 19:21:56 +0000 (21:21 +0200)]
chore: fix repo and issue urls and license in package.json and plugin.xml
Jan Piotrowski [Thu, 27 Jun 2019 19:15:40 +0000 (21:15 +0200)]
build: add `.npmignore` to remove unneeded files from npm package
Jan Piotrowski [Thu, 27 Jun 2019 19:15:22 +0000 (21:15 +0200)]
build: add `.gitattributes` to force LF (instead of possible CRLF on Windows)
Jan Piotrowski [Thu, 20 Jun 2019 13:19:13 +0000 (15:19 +0200)]
ci(travis): Update Travis CI configuration for new paramedic (#478)
* Update Travis CI configuration for new paramedic
* remove wrong ADDITIONAL_TESTS_DIR
* Update .travis.yml
* remove failing platform
Jan Piotrowski [Thu, 20 Jun 2019 13:18:42 +0000 (15:18 +0200)]
docs: remove outdated translations
Ralph Gutkowski [Wed, 12 Jun 2019 19:03:23 +0000 (21:03 +0200)]
Fix beforeload for Android <= 7 (#427)
* Fix beforeload for Android <= 7
* Change Android version check conditional
Jesse MacFadyen [Tue, 9 Apr 2019 17:49:41 +0000 (10:49 -0700)]
Fix failing CI tests (#460)
* bump node version to 6
* use default travis osx_image of xcode9.4
* comment out flakey local test
Jesse MacFadyen [Wed, 6 Mar 2019 08:00:48 +0000 (00:00 -0800)]
Merge pull request #440 from cordova-develop/fix-close-event-test
Fix test spec.5 to close inappbrowser after loadstop event
Jesse MacFadyen [Wed, 6 Mar 2019 07:55:34 +0000 (23:55 -0800)]
Merge pull request #383 from cvanem/master
Example documentation - Fix messageCallBack and beforeloadCallBack function names
Jesse MacFadyen [Wed, 6 Mar 2019 07:31:12 +0000 (23:31 -0800)]
Merge pull request #262 from landsbankinn/CB-13969
Cb 13969 - Allow close button and navigation buttons positions to be swapped
Jesse MacFadyen [Wed, 6 Mar 2019 07:27:13 +0000 (23:27 -0800)]
Merge pull request #439 from apache/revert-353-patch-1
Revert "Add support for right to left direction languages"
I mistakenly merged #353 instead of a similar one.
KNaito [Wed, 6 Mar 2019 02:47:21 +0000 (11:47 +0900)]
Fix test spec.5 to close inappbrowser after loadstop event
Jesse MacFadyen [Wed, 6 Mar 2019 01:56:34 +0000 (17:56 -0800)]
Revert "Add support for right to left direction languages"
Jesse MacFadyen [Wed, 6 Mar 2019 01:34:19 +0000 (17:34 -0800)]
Merge pull request #353 from transoceanic/patch-1
Add support for right to left direction languages
Jesse MacFadyen [Sat, 2 Mar 2019 04:54:49 +0000 (20:54 -0800)]
Merge pull request #436 from purplecabbage/ValidateCallbackId
[android] Prevent malformed callbackId from reaching app cordova view
Jesse MacFadyen [Thu, 28 Feb 2019 22:52:01 +0000 (14:52 -0800)]
Prevent malformed callbackId from reaching app cordova view
Steinar Ágúst [Thu, 28 Feb 2019 15:17:24 +0000 (15:17 +0000)]
CB-13969 fixing README to be correct for lefttoright option
Steinar Ágúst [Thu, 28 Feb 2019 14:39:26 +0000 (14:39 +0000)]
CB-13969 functionality extended to WKWebView
steinaragustli [Thu, 28 Feb 2019 14:11:04 +0000 (14:11 +0000)]
CB-13969 fix inappbrowser.css to be unmodified
Steinar Ágúst [Thu, 28 Feb 2019 14:05:05 +0000 (14:05 +0000)]
CB-13969 reverting to older version of inappbrowser.css to leave it out of PR
Steinar Á. Steinarsson [Thu, 28 Feb 2019 13:04:21 +0000 (13:04 +0000)]
CB-13969 trying to fix some wierd issue for PR
Steinar Á. Steinarsson [Thu, 28 Feb 2019 13:02:04 +0000 (13:02 +0000)]
CB-13969 trying to fix some wierd issue for PR